Four States Adopt Retirement Systems Local retirement systems have been created in four states during the last year. The legislature of Colorado auth­ orized extension of the state employees’ retirement system to all municipal, county and school district employees. A statewide municipal employees’ re­ tirement system, was established by the Pennsylvania, legislature, effective in September. The Texas legislature gave approval to a proposed constitutional amend­ ment to authorize municipalities to es­ tablish retirement and disability pension systems for their employees and also per­ m itting the legislature to establish a statewide pension system for municipal employees. In Wisconsin a new statute provides for an optional statewide retirement sys­ tem for employees of any city or vil­ lage except Milwaukee, covered by pre­ vious legislation. The Ohio general assembly has cre­ ated a commission of nine members to study and consider salary problems of all public officials and employees in the state.
